We are delighted to announce that Actavis Malta is the title sponsor of this year’s LifeCycle Challenge.
This exciting news was briefed at a press launch tonight (17th April 2013) at Actavis Malta headquarters in Bulebel. After a brief introduction by LifeCycle secretary Shirley Cefai, Actavis Vice-President for Manufacturing Operations in Western Europe Sergio Vella gave a short speech about the company’s support for LifeCycle, and this was followed by short speeches from LifeCycle co-founder Tony Bugeja, Paul Calleja from the Mater Dei Renal Unit, LifeCycle chairman and co-founder Alan Curry, and challenge organiser Soner Gurelli.
Actavis have supported the LifeCycle Challenge since 2001 and we are pleased to be partnering with a company that operates in the healthcare sector. As part of their sponsorship, Actavis will be donating a generous and significant €20,000 to this year’s fundraising effort by the LifeCycle (Malta) Foundation.
